Step-by-step

Step 1
The porcelain brush pens in attractive shades of blue and green are available in a handy set of 6. Before you start decorating, first wash the plate with water then wipe over with methylated spirits. Thorough cleaning is essential in order to remove any invisible protective film applied during manufacture. Next, paint your motif onto the rim of your plate, stroke by stroke, line by line. We recommend that you only decorate the rim because the use of cutlery could damage the design over time.

Step 2
If you go wrong or your design isn’t to your liking, simply wipe off with a damp cloth or correct with a damp cotton bud and repaint. Once you‘re happy with your design, leave the plate to dry for 15 minutes and preheat your oven to 160°C (heated from the top and bottom). Place the plate on a cold rack and bake your design for 25 minutes and allow to cool in the oven. Your decorative design will now be dishwasher-safe up to 50°C.
Products and materials
Other materials
- Porcelain plate
- Water and methylated spirits for initial cleaning
- A damp cloth or cotton buds for corrections
- A conventional oven
